Comment on solubility

Solubility of 2-(2-octadecanoyloxypropanoyloxy)propanoic acid

The solubility of 2-(2-octadecanoyloxypropanoyloxy)propanoic acid can be characterized by a few key factors that affect its behavior in different solvents. This compound is a long-chain fatty acid derivative, and its solubility profile is influenced by both its hydrophobic and hydrophilic regions.

Some important points regarding its solubility include:

  • Hydrophobic Nature: The long octadecanoyl chain is primarily hydrophobic, which generally leads to lower solubility in polar solvents like water.
  • Polar Functional Groups: The presence of the carboxylic acid functional group may enhance solubility in polar solvents, although its effect may be mitigated by the large hydrophobic portion of the molecule.
  • Solvent dependency: 2-(2-octadecanoyloxypropanoyloxy)propanoic acid is likely soluble in nonpolar organic solvents, such as hexane or octanol, due to its nonpolar characteristics.

In summary, while the polar areas of 2-(2-octadecanoyloxypropanoyloxy)propanoic acid provide opportunities for interactions with water, the predominance of hydrophobic character due to the long carbon chain results in limited solubility in aqueous environments. Therefore, it may be more effectively dissolved in less polar solvents.
